    Southington, Conn.-based Thomas Products Ltd.’s Model 2100 is constructed with polysulfone (an FDA approved material). It’s an in-line flow switch used for detecting insufficient flow rates in liquids. One feature is the incorporation of a low flow orifice and adapter assembly, which makes the flow switch capable of set points as low as 1 cc/min. in water. Without this assembly, the unit can yield high set points up to 1.5 gpm. This unit can withstand pressure at 250 psig at 70 degreesF and temperatures up to 225 degrees F.
